在我Windows桌面程序,我希望能够允许用户选择的文本浏览器这是我的节目将使用。

默认情况下,我会让它设置得的节目(s)他采用查看。TXT文件,我可以找到足够容易地从该登记册。但他可能需要更改以使用记事本或写字板或其他一些程序(例如UltraEdit).

这是我想出来的对话框:

File Viewer Selection Dialog Box
(资料来源: beholdgenealogy.com)

实际上我有两个问题:

  1. 是有一个建议的用户界面,用于本(即某种对话,我应该使用)?

  2. 是有一个简单的方法检查,一旦使用者输入一个计划可执行的,它的确是能够文观看?

有帮助吗?

解决方案

大多数应用程序只是你一个开放的对话文件,虽然那似乎有点粗。你能提供一个列表中的使用 这篇文章 查询windows列表的文件的协会。还提供了一个功能挑选一个方案使用一个文件的对话。

没有没有一种方式来检查新的exe可以处理txt文件。一旦你把该文件关于这一进程中,你只需要希望它的工作。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top